Managing Bookmarked Items on iOS Devices
iOS devices offer several methods for managing items saved for quick access. These saved items are often referred to as favorites or bookmarks, depending on the application.
Safari Web Browser Bookmarks
Deleting Individual Bookmarks
Within the Safari application, users can delete individual bookmarks by navigating to the Bookmarks section, locating the desired item, swiping left on the entry, and tapping "Delete".
Deleting Multiple Bookmarks
Selecting multiple bookmarks for deletion is possible by tapping "Edit" in the Bookmarks view. Users can then select individual bookmarks by tapping on their respective circles. After selecting the desired bookmarks, tapping "Delete" will remove them.
Managing Bookmark Folders
Bookmarks can be organized into folders for improved management. Users can create, rename, and delete folders, moving bookmarks between them as needed. Deleting a folder will also delete all bookmarks contained within.
Other Applications
The method for removing saved items varies based on the specific application. Many applications use similar swipe-to-delete functionality as described for Safari. Some applications offer a dedicated "Manage Favorites" or similar option within their settings menu.
